New Year's Resolutions: Achievable Goals to Kick-Start 2024

As we embark on a fresh start in 2024, many Americans are setting their sights on New Year's resolutions. According to a recent local tv channel poll, an impressive 37% of Americans have committed to making resolutions this year. It comes as no surprise that the top resolutions focus on improving health, exercising, spending quality time with loved ones, and adopting healthier eating habits.

To shed light on the secrets of achieving resolutions, we turn to Wendy Walsh, a psychology professor at Cal State University Channel Islands. With her expert guidance, it becomes evident that willpower alone is not the key to success. Our brains are wired to seek instant gratification, which often leads to the development of bad habits or compulsions. Professor Walsh urges us to abandon the notion of relying solely on willpower.

The first tip she shares is to focus on changing only one behavior at a time. Attempting to tackle multiple goals simultaneously can overwhelm us. However, the good news is that achieving one goal sets the stage for success in pursuing subsequent ones. So, take it one step at a time.

Identifying triggers is another vital step in the resolution journey. Professor Walsh encourages us to reflect on the patterns preceding our bad habits. For instance, imagine coming home and automatically lighting up a cigarette while lounging in your favorite chair. By rearranging your living room furniture, you disrupt the trigger and gain awareness of your actions. Moreover, consider swapping that harmful habit with a healthier alternative, like going for a walk or engaging in exercise.

Creating a reward system is another effective tool in maintaining resolutions. By acknowledging the progress made, we can motivate ourselves to keep pushing forward. Treat yourself to a rejuvenating massage after successfully abstaining from vaping for three days, or consider depositing some money into a savings account instead of spending it on cigarettes. Not only will this boost your finances, but it will also serve as a tangible reminder of your achievements.

Support from friends, family, or even online communities can make a significant difference in our ability to stick to our resolutions. Surround yourself with individuals who share similar goals or those who can provide guidance and encouragement along the way. Remember, you're not alone on this journey.

Lastly, setbacks are a natural part of any resolution pursuit. Instead of viewing them as failures, Professor Walsh encourages us to see setbacks as opportunities for growth. By analyzing the vulnerabilities that led to the setback, we can develop strategies to overcome similar obstacles in the future. Identify triggers, evaluate your surroundings, and refine your approach.

As we set out to conquer our resolutions in 2024, it's crucial to establish achievable and specific goals. Rather than a vague desire to 'get healthier,' focus on tangible actions such as reducing sugar intake by eliminating bread, pasta, and desserts or committing to four 30-minute workout sessions per week. Concrete resolutions increase the likelihood of success.
